Up to now, there is no final Cinevia product in its own cartridge. The Cinevia you can buy today is a film in a KODAK cartridge. Mr. Klose of GK-Film always said: We will not use the Kodak cartridge because of all those problems with jamming and, and, and... Now he is using the Kodak cartridge becau...

Good news: E100D is priced like E64T, that saves 10 $/Euro per cartridge compared to WittnerChrome 100D or Pro8mm stuff.
Bad news: Plus X is discontinued, also in 16 mm
Ektachrome 64T will end soon, too
